| Summary: | The first integral method can be used to construct exact traveling wave solutions of nonlinear partial differential equations. In this work, we explore new application of this method to some special nonlinear partial differential equations. By means of this method, the exact solutions of the B(n,n) equation and the generalized sine-Gordon equation and a kind of nonlinear reaction–diffusion equation and generalized form of the double sinh-Gordon equation are obtained. |
